Output e843836b2596b93828f650984dfe4ec1a8b8f16353c4ca560d0f5bdda76d886e:1

value
57136214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b62c2430d4b7f5381f06113ad1f59235126658c OP_EQUALVERIFY OP_CHECKSIG
address
1KYQUpttypTiozxSVxVbTE5GtvJQcd6M6U
transaction
e843836b2596b93828f650984dfe4ec1a8b8f16353c4ca560d0f5bdda76d886e
spent
true